Shadcn Toggle

A two-state button that can be either on or off. Browse our collection of 7 Shadcn Toggle variants.

Single

Multiple

Unlock premium components
Get full control of shadcn/ui components, blocks and instances, including future additions.

Shadcn Toggle Component

The Shadcn Toggle is a button toggle React component for creating toggleable button groups and state buttons. Built with React, TypeScript, and Tailwind CSS, it provides a production-ready solution for toggleable button states.

What is the Shadcn Toggle Component?

The Shadcn Toggle displays a button that can be pressed to toggle between active and inactive states. It consists of Toggle and ToggleGroup sub-components for single and multiple selections. Built on Radix UI primitives, it's unstyled by default, giving you complete control over styling with Tailwind CSS.